九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 android鏅鸿兘瀹跺眳绯荤粺璁捐, 引言

android鏅鸿兘瀹跺眳绯荤粺璁捐, 引言

时间:2024-09-28 来源:网络 人气:

Android 鏅鸿兘瀹跺眳绯荤粺璁捐:深度解析与优化技巧

引言

随着移动互联网的快速发展,Android 系统已经成为全球的操作系统之一。在 Android 应用开发过程中,鏅鸿兘瀹跺眳绯荤粺璁捐(性能优化)成为开发者关注的焦点。本文将深入解析 Android 鏅鸿兘瀹跺眳绯荤粺璁捐,并提供一些优化技巧,帮助开发者提升应用性能。

一、Android 鏅鸿兘瀹跺眳绯荤粺璁捐概述

1.1 性能优化的意义

性能优化是 Android 应用开发过程中的重要环节,它直接影响着应用的流畅度、响应速度和用户体验。通过性能优化,可以提高应用的运行效率,降低资源消耗,提升用户满意度。

1.2 性能优化的目标

- 降低 CPU 负载

- 减少内存占用

- 提高内存访问速度

- 降低功耗

- 提升用户体验

二、Android 鏅鸿兘瀹跺眳绯荤粺璁捐方法

2.1 代码优化

2.1.1 避免过度使用线程

- 使用线程池管理线程

- 避免在主线程中执行耗时操作

- 使用异步任务处理耗时操作

2.1.2 优化循环

- 使用 for 循环代替 while 循环

- 避免在循环中执行耗时操作

- 使用 break 和 continue 语句优化循环

2.1.3 优化集合操作

- 使用 HashMap 和 ArrayList 替代 LinkedList

- 避免在集合操作中使用迭代器

- 使用并行集合操作

2.2 内存优化

2.2.1 避免内存泄漏

- 使用弱引用处理静态变量

- 及时释放不再使用的对象

- 使用 Android Profiler 检测内存泄漏

2.2.2 优化对象创建

- 使用对象池管理对象

- 避免频繁创建和销毁对象

- 使用缓存机制

2.3 界面优化

2.3.1 优化布局

- 使用 ConstraintLayout 替代RelativeLayout

- 避免使用嵌套布局

- 使用 ViewStub 缓存视图

2.3.2 优化动画

- 使用属性动画代替帧动画

- 避免在动画中使用耗时操作

- 使用硬件加速


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载